Scripture Focus

4And over the course of the second month was Dodai an Ahohite, and of his course was Mikloth also the ruler: in his course likewise were twenty and four thousand.
1 Chronicles 27:4

Biblical Context

The verse records a structured leadership: Dodai over the second month, with Mikloth as ruler of his course, and 24,000 under his charge.

Neville's Inner Vision

In the inner landscape, the second month is a cycle of attention where a steadfast state assumes command. Dodai, the tested guard, represents a fixed consciousness keeping watch over your tempo; Mikloth, ruling his course, signifies the directing idea or habit that allocates your energy. The twenty-four thousand symbolize the collective energy of your thoughts and actions, organized into service of a singular aim. You are not subject to external clockwork; you are the I AM who assigns states of consciousness to courses within your mind. By choosing a consistent, vital course—what you believe and live in imagination—you marshal a disciplined army of inner faculties. When you align the ruler (your guiding idea) with the second month (the present moment’s tempo), your life flows with unity and purposeful creation. The kingdom you build in awareness becomes actualized as you dwell in the feeling of the wish fulfilled, and the outward scene rearranges to reflect that inner alignment.

Practice This Now

Assume, right now, 'I am the ruler of my inner month.' Feel the second month as a steady tempo and imagine 24,000 inner workers aligning to your purpose; dwell in the quiet conviction that it is so.
